grigor007
@grigor007
http://goldapp.ru

Какова логика работа php opCache?

Здравствуйте,

кто может растолковать, как работает php opCache? Нет, я знаю, что он байт код хранит в памяти, но если у меня есть php скрипт который в зависимости от авторизованного пользователя выглядит оп разному, а значит для каждого пользователя это уникальный байт-код, то php opCache будет хранить огромное количество скомпилированного кода в памяти?

Память же быстро кончится и в чем тогда смысл opCache? Кто-нибудь может объяснить на примере..
  • Вопрос задан
  • 594 просмотра
Решения вопроса 1
alsopub
@alsopub
есть php скрипт который в зависимости от авторизованного пользователя выглядит оп разному

Это как выгляди физически?
Результат работы скрипта - да, выглядит по-разному для каждого пользователя.
Так байт-код кеш не его кеширует, а сами алгоритмы генерации страницы.
Грубо говоря экономится время на парсинг файла, построение дерева операций, вычисление выражений, состоящих из констант и тд.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ы